What Does P0203 Mean?

P0203 is a generic powertrain diagnostic trouble code. It indicates an injector circuit malfunction involving engine cylinder 3.

A fuel injector is an electrically controlled valve that meters fuel into the engine. The powertrain control module, or PCM, switches the injector on and off through its control circuit.

The PCM monitors voltage and current in that circuit. It stores P0203 when the observed electrical behavior falls outside the expected range.

  • P: The fault affects the powertrain.
  • 0: It is a generic OBD2 code.
  • 2: The code belongs to the fuel and air metering group.
  • 03: The problem involves injector circuit 3.

P0203 identifies a circuit, not a confirmed failed injector. Wiring and connector faults can produce the same code.

Cylinder numbering also varies by engine design. Check the manufacturer’s service information before testing or disconnecting an injector.

What Causes P0203?

Mechanic inspecting damaged injector wiring and connector for common P0203 causes.
Injector, connector, wiring, power, and PCM faults can all trigger P0203.

The leading P0203 causes are an electrically failed injector, damaged wiring, poor terminal contact, or lost power. PCM failure is possible, but it is much less common.

1. Open or Shorted Fuel Injector Coil

Inside each injector is an electromagnetic coil. An open coil cannot carry current, while a shorted coil may draw excessive current.

Either condition can trigger P0203. Comparing cylinder 3 resistance with matching injectors often reveals a clear difference.

Technician’s note: Injector resistance specifications vary. Use the specification for your exact engine instead of relying on a universal number.

2. Damaged Injector Wiring

Injector wiring lives near heat, vibration, sharp brackets, and moving engine parts. Its insulation can harden, rub through, or break internally.

Common damage points include:

  • Harness sections touching valve-cover edges or brackets
  • Wires stretched during previous engine repairs
  • Insulation damaged by oil or excessive heat
  • Rodent-damaged wiring under an engine cover
  • Internal breaks near a connector strain-relief point

A wire can look intact while its conductor is broken. That is why a visual inspection alone may not confirm the circuit’s condition.

3. Loose, Corroded, or Damaged Connector

A loose injector plug may disconnect briefly as the engine moves. Corrosion or a spread terminal can also add resistance and disrupt current.

Look for green deposits, bent pins, moisture, broken locks, and terminals pushed backward into the connector body.

In hands-on diagnostic work, I often find connector trouble after recent valve-cover or intake repairs. The plug may appear connected even though its lock never fully engaged.

4. Injector Power Supply Problem

Many engines provide shared battery voltage to several injectors. The PCM then controls each injector through a separate ground-side driver.

A blown fuse, failed relay, or damaged shared feed may therefore produce several injector codes. P0203 alone usually points more strongly toward the cylinder 3 branch.

Compare the pattern with nearby circuit faults, including documented P0201 causes and P0202 causes. Multiple adjacent codes can indicate a shared harness or power problem.

5. Faulty PCM Injector Driver

The PCM contains an electronic driver that controls each injector. A shorted injector or wiring fault can sometimes damage that driver.

PCM failure should be considered only after injector, power, ground, connector, and continuity tests pass. Replacing the computer first is an expensive guess.

Programming note: A replacement PCM may require vehicle-specific setup, immobilizer pairing, or key programming. Confirm those requirements before approving the repair.

Section Takeaway: Most P0203 faults are found at the injector, connector, or nearby wiring. Prove those circuits before suspecting the PCM.

Which Symptoms Help Narrow Down the Cause?

P0203 often causes a noticeable cylinder 3 misfire. The exact symptoms depend on whether the fault is constant or intermittent.

Common P0203 symptoms include:

  • A steady or flashing check-engine light
  • Rough idle or engine shaking
  • Hesitation during acceleration
  • Reduced engine power
  • Hard starting or stalling
  • Higher fuel consumption
  • A raw-fuel smell in some failure conditions

A constant dead cylinder suggests an open circuit, failed injector, or major terminal problem. A fault that appears over bumps may point toward loose wiring.

A cold-only or heat-related failure can indicate an injector coil or connection changing resistance with temperature. Record when the problem occurs before clearing any codes.

Misfire codes such as P0303 may appear with P0203. The circuit code deserves priority because the injector electrical fault can directly cause the misfire.

How Do You Diagnose P0203 Correctly?

Diagnose P0203 by confirming the code, inspecting the circuit, and testing injector power and control. Do not replace the injector based only on the scanner description.

Step 1: Read Every Code and Save Freeze-Frame Data

Scan all vehicle modules and record stored, pending, and permanent codes. Save engine speed, temperature, voltage, and load from the freeze frame.

Do not immediately erase the results. The difference between permanent and stored OBD2 codes can affect how you confirm the repair.

Step 2: Inspect the Injector and Harness

Turn off the ignition before disconnecting components. Check cylinder identification through reliable service information.

  1. Inspect the cylinder 3 injector plug and locking tab.
  2. Look for corrosion, oil intrusion, bent pins, or backed-out terminals.
  3. Follow the harness toward the PCM and shared power source.
  4. Check areas near brackets, covers, and hot exhaust components.
  5. Gently move the harness while watching for visible damage.

Step 3: Compare Injector Electrical Readings

With the circuit safely isolated, compare cylinder 3 injector resistance with an identical injector. A major difference may reveal an open or shorted coil.

Resistance alone does not prove the injector works mechanically. However, it helps determine whether the coil can explain the circuit code.

Step 4: Test Power and PCM Control

A technician can check the injector’s power feed with a suitable meter. A noid light or oscilloscope can show whether the PCM provides a control pulse.

Use tools designed for automotive circuits. Incorrect probing can spread terminals, short a driver, or damage the PCM.

Safety note: Never pierce insulation or apply battery power to a PCM-controlled wire without an approved test procedure.

Step 5: Confirm Continuity Before Condemning the PCM

If the injector and power feed pass, test the control wire for an open, short to ground, or short to voltage. Disconnect modules as directed by service information before resistance testing.

The following comparison helps organize the results:

FindingLikely CauseNext Check
No injector powerFuse, relay, or shared feed faultCheck other injectors and wiring diagrams
Cylinder 3 resistance differs greatlyOpen or shorted injector coilVerify against the manufacturer specification
Signal changes when harness movesBroken wire or loose terminalInspect and load-test the affected section
Injector and wiring pass, but no controlPossible PCM driver faultCheck driver operation and technical bulletins

After repairing the fault, clear eligible codes and complete an appropriate drive cycle. Rescan the vehicle and confirm that P0203 does not return.

Section Takeaway: A scanner locates the affected circuit, while electrical tests identify the failed part. Confirmation after the repair prevents repeat visits.

Can You Drive With P0203?

You should avoid driving farther than necessary with an active P0203 code. A dead injector can cause severe shaking, stalling, reduced acceleration, or unpredictable power.

Stop driving and arrange assistance when you notice:

  • A flashing check-engine light
  • Severe engine shaking
  • Stalling or difficulty maintaining speed
  • Smoke or a strong raw-fuel odor
  • Unusual heat or electrical burning smells

Continued misfiring may overheat and damage the catalytic converter. It can also leave the vehicle unable to accelerate safely.

How Much Does P0203 Cost to Fix?

Service advisor explaining estimated P0203 repair costs for injector, wiring, relay, or PCM work.
P0203 repair costs vary widely depending on the failed circuit component.

P0203 repair cost depends on the failed component, labor access, vehicle design, and local rates. Diagnosis commonly takes one to two labor hours before any repair begins.

Possible RepairTypical Broad RangeImportant Variable
Connector or minor wiring repair$100–$450Damage location and harness access
Single fuel injector replacement$250–$800Injector type and intake removal
Fuse or relay repair$100–$300Underlying short must be found
PCM replacement and programming$800–$2,500 or moreModule availability and programming

These are planning ranges, not quotes. Prices vary by make, model, year, engine, region, and parts choice.

Frequently Asked Questions About P0203

Can a bad fuel injector cause P0203?

Yes. An injector with an open or shorted electrical coil can cause P0203. A clogged injector may cause a misfire, but clogging alone does not always create an injector circuit code.

Can a bad spark plug cause P0203?

A worn spark plug can cause a cylinder 3 misfire, but it normally does not cause an injector circuit code. If P0203 and P0303 appear together, diagnose the injector circuit first.

Can a blown fuse trigger P0203?

Yes, if the fuse supplies power to the injectors. However, a shared fuse failure will often affect several cylinders and create multiple injector circuit codes.

Will clearing P0203 fix the problem?

No. Clearing the code only removes stored diagnostic information. P0203 will return when the PCM detects the electrical fault again.

Can a weak battery cause P0203?

Low system voltage can create confusing electrical symptoms, especially during starting. A repeated cylinder-specific P0203 code is more likely to involve the injector, its connector, wiring, or PCM driver.

Is cylinder 3 always in the same location?

No. Cylinder numbering depends on the engine layout and manufacturer. Confirm cylinder 3 through service information for the exact year, make, model, and engine.

Should I replace all injectors when P0203 appears?

Not automatically. Replace only the parts proven faulty unless testing or manufacturer guidance supports replacing a complete injector set.
